A Graduate Certificate in Incident Management Essentials provides professionals with the critical skills and knowledge needed to effectively handle and resolve incidents across various industries. This specialized program focuses on developing proactive strategies and reactive responses to disruptions, minimizing impact and ensuring business continuity.
Learning outcomes for this Graduate Certificate in Incident Management Essentials include mastering incident response methodologies, developing effective communication strategies during crises, and improving overall organizational resilience. Participants will gain practical experience through simulations and case studies, preparing them for real-world scenarios.
The program's duration typically ranges from six to twelve months, depending on the institution and the chosen course load. This intensive yet manageable timeframe allows working professionals to upskill without extensive time commitments, enhancing career prospects in IT, cybersecurity, and operations management.
This Graduate Certificate in Incident Management Essentials is highly relevant to various sectors, including IT service management (ITSM), cybersecurity incident response, and business continuity planning.
